IOE Research & Development Network Building expertise and capacity for collaborative research and development

What is the Network all about?The IOE Research & Development Network aims to bring together colleagues across education to:

• make a step-change in research engagement and research use, with a particular focus on equity and social justice, leading to tangible improvements in practice and positive impact for member schools and their pupils

• provide succour for intellectual and professional development and a rigorous space to connect with other leaders, key thinkers and evidence in ways that allow you to innovate and evaluate new ways of working.

Joining the Network will enable your school or alliance/network to work with IOE facilitators and researchers as well as other network members to:

• engage with research - facilitating access to the knowledge base• engage in research - generating practice-based knowledge• extend the knowledge base - combining researcher and practitioner knowledge• evaluate impact - understanding and

evidencing the difference we make for learners.

Core membership costs:Library Reference Membership is free for all Network member schools and staff.

£2250 Up to 5 schools External borrowing library membership for 3 staff 1 free conference pass, 3 discounted event places

£4000 Up to 10 schools External borrowing for 5 staff 2 free conference passes, 6 discounted event places

£5000 Up to 15 schools External borrowing for 8 staff 4 free conference passes, 8 discounted event places

£6000 Up to 20 schools External borrowing for 10 staff 6 free conference passes, 10 discounted event places

Additional borrowing rights will be charged at the reduced price of £100 per card.

Core membership costs for groups or alliances of more than 20 schools are by negotiation.

Costs for bespoke activity are determined by the nature of the activity and may include LCLL core membership for an individual school.

Membership runs from 1st September to 31st August.

Contact [email protected] to discuss your requirements.

The IOE Specialist Partner Award (Research and Development) may be for you. This is one of three School Partnership Awards, the others being for Initial Teacher Education (ITE) and Professional and Leadership Development.

To be designated, a named school, working with a group of other schools will meet a set of clear criteria in terms of the depth, duration and quality of its work in partnership with the IOE. Schools achieving all three awards may progress to IOE Principal Partner.
